Introduction

Designed, Engineered and Manufactured in Sri Lanka by Bravo Solutions, Bravo Programmable Digital Power Guard “DigiGUARD” possesses proven protection with innovative technology backed by Comnet Labs Sweden, designed to provide Over Voltage, Surge, Under Voltage (sag, brown-out) and Overload protection at the AC mains. Bravo DigiGUARD is a totally unique fully automatic micro-processor controlled protective device, factory set to provide a safe operating window for the directly connected equipment. It is designed for a 230Volt 50Hz AC Mains electrical supply. Its performance is tested and certified by ACCIMT, SINGER and DAMRO in Sri Lanka through un-biased testing.

As soon as the AC voltage supply moves outside the safe operating window depicted by the operating mode, it immediately switches OFF power to the protected equipment and remains OFF until a safe mains supply voltage is detected, giving sensitive equipment proper protection when needed. It also provides the connected equipment with a vital minimum time delay before power is restored.

Unlike lower quality products in the market, Bravo DigiGUARD is not earth dependent or Amperage Imbalance Reacting, therefore events such as loss of a Neutral line and the resultant continuous high voltage is rapidly detected and protection is activated in a split second (Thanks to 8-bit Microprocessor technology), without damaging your vital electrical or electronic equipment. DigiGUARD also indicates the supply voltage variations clearly on the LED screen. This is what we call reliable protection 24/7.

Inspection and Changing the Fuse

If the Power Guard is not working, it can be a fuse failure. The fuse is designed to get burnt during an Overload or High Voltage condition, thus preventing further damage to the electronics of the DigiGUARD and the connected appliances. There are two fuses protecting the Live wire and the Neutral wire separately through the Built-in Surge Protector. The fuse for the Live wire is located inside the Power adapter plug. Open the plug using a screwdriver and replace the fuse with a similar one (13A fuse is factory installed). Do not pull out the connected wires too much since that can damage the internal circuitry. The other fuse is protecting the Neutral wire and is located outside as a conventional screw type fuse. 7A fuse is factory installed for Neutral Line Protection.

Always send our products to the factory for any other repairs. Never give this unit to other repair technicians since that may damage the internal circuitry beyond repair.

Installation and Operation

DigiGUARD QRO is designed to handle High Powered Appliances like Air conditioners, High Power water pumps, High Power Sound systems etc.. It can withstand a running power of 4000W and a startup power of 5500W. This product comes in with a 13A suqare plug/base.

Install the DigiGUARD QRO in a dry and dust-free location inaccessible to Children. Never place the product on ground. Wall mounting using the supported flange is highly recommended. During Power startup, select the proper operating mode using UP/DOWN keys for your desired appliance.

Refer to the user manual for more details. Operating mode change is supported only at Power startup for added safety.
